FRANCISTOWN: The city of Francistown is in mourning following the sudden death of former city mayor, and councillor for Phillip Matante ward, Shadreck Nyeku, who passed away on Monday evening.

The Botswana Movement for Democracy (BMD) councillor, who was also the Francistown regional chairperson collapsed during a party meeting held at Phatsimo Primary School and was declared dead on arrival in hospital.

Nyeku, who had served Francistown City Council (FCC) as a councillor from 2009, was once a member of the Botswana People’s Party (BPP), and later joined the ruling party before defecting to the BMD in 2010.
